Discovery of Hydrogen Radio Recombination Lines at z = 0.89 toward PKS 1830-211
We report the detection of stimulated hydrogen radio recombination line (RRL) emission from ionized gas in a z = 0.89 galaxy using 580–1670 MHz observations from the MeerKAT Absorption Line Survey.

Tracking Outflow Using Line Locking (TOLL). I. The Case Study of Quasar J221531-174408
Investigating line-locked phenomena within quasars is crucial for understanding the dynamics of quasar outflows, the role of radiation pressure in astrophysical flows, and the star formation history and metallicity of the early Universe.
